A MAN has been detained on suspicion of chopping off the hand of his girlfriend’s son, police said in Shenyang, capital of northeast China’s Liaoning Province.
Doctors said the 10-year-old boy had his right hand cut off. He was sent for emergency treatment in the wee hours of yesterday. He is in stable condition but his hand, found in a cup filled with hot water, couldn’t be reattached.
Police said the 30-year-old suspect surnamed Wang had money disputes with the boy’s mother, local Chinese Business Morning View reported today.
The incident occurred at a hotel in Tiexi District. A hotel worker said they had lived there for about two months. They claimed they were a family of three and their house was being renovated, she told the newspaper.
The worker said the boy’s mother was in Hangzhou, capital of Zhejiang Province, yesterday.
Police said the boy was unwilling to blame Wang and refused to give any details. “He is a nice person. He treats me well,” the boy said, and called Wang “father.”
